The Boeing Company has an exciting opportunity for an Experienced/Senior Electronic Systems Design and Analysis Engineer for current and emerging fixed wing fighter programs located in Berkeley, MO. These programs include: F-47 - the next generation fighter for the Air Force, T-7A - the next generation trainer for the Air Force, F/A-18, EA-18G, F-15, F-22 - production tactical fighter aircraft ongoing major upgrades, and several programs within the Phantom Works organization. At Boeing, our Electrical Engineers develop and test electronic and electrical system requirements using analytical and technical skills, translate requirements into system architectures and modify hardware and software designs for Boeing aircraft, unmanned vehicles and much more. As a member of the team, you will lead the development and execution of new Mission Computing solutions for emerging and existing fixed wing fighter programs. Upon successful design of an architecture that meets all system requirements, this individual will lead the engineering team in its implementation and maintenance of that design through the development, lab test and flight test phases of the development cycle.

  • Leads activities to develop, document and maintain avionics architectures, requirements, algorithms, interfaces and designs.
  • Serves as a subject matter expert for system level architecture, system-specific issues, and processes.
  • Leads the engineering team in implementation of Open Mission Systems (OMS) and Model Based Systems Engineering (MBSE) tools and processes.
  • Works with specialty engineering teams to decompose requirements to the Mission Computer to ensure performance, safety critical, and environmental requirements are understood and implemented.
  • Works with internal and external stakeholders to coordinate execution of ongoing hardware-software integration efforts in a fast-paced Agile environment.
  • Works with customers and aircrew to develop and document complex electronic and electrical system requirements.
  • Receives customer requests and analyzes them with consideration for contractual and technical impacts and translates into actionable system requirements.
  • Provides technical leadership for investigation of emerging technologies, technical planning and integration of new technology implementation, and technology demonstrations.
  • Resolves product integration issues and production anomalies.
  • Solves problems concerning fielded hardware and software over the entire product lifecycle.
